\r\n \r\n ok so i got my bracket. decided id do a little break down on the install. honestly it pretty easy. so heres the pic of it before i pulled old adjusting block off and put on the new A TEK bracket(which came with some big ass A TEK stickers- REPRESENTIN)
\n
\n
\n slid it on and threw the nut back on. i did have to de-adjust the chain tensioner bolt cause the bracket is longer by a little bit(to give it more leverage and not alow any slop).
\n
\n i am using a right side 03 636 front caliper just because the bleeder is on top but u can use either side. i just loosely installed it for now to get an idea of where i am going to have to do a light trimming so that way i can have 100% pad contact on the rotor once i trim it to where the pads are in full contact.
\n<a href="http://s789.photobucket.com/albums/yy177/mdub4life29/?action=view&amp;current=1291010013377.jpg" target="_blank"><img src="http://i789.photobucket.com/albums/yy177/mdub4life29/th_1291010013377.jpg" border="0" alt="Photobucket" ></a>
\n i will measure to see how tall of a spacer i need and go get one from the hardware store. this is all the further i have gotten tonight im about 4 mintes into the install. been really smooth so far. ill post more pics when i get a little more time to work on it and it isnt as late\r\n
